I remembred something from years back that I did & thought I'd mention it. I had dug an old transportation token from Seymour, Texas. It basically gave a guaranteed ride from the train to the hotel and back. It was in good shape and I wondered how it got to Arizona. Anyway, I looked on the net and found several men who dealt in these things and wrote to them, accompanied by a picture of the token.
The best offer wrote back and said he would give me $125.00 for it. I then went to a local coin dealer, well known in my city, & I showed him several tokens I had dug and wondered what he would pay for them. When he saw the one from Texas he casually said "give you 25 bux". I then said a dealer in Texas offered me 125 where upon he said "I'll give you $130.00". Got a good laugh out of that one. But I said I had already told the Texas man I would sell it to him - which I hadn't but would not sell to the local guy just for trying to jack me on the deal. I did send it to the dealer after he paid me.
So if you dig a token from elsewhere, check the internet and see, but watch out for the snakes around you , Steve in so az
